About the Role

As Chief People Officer, you’ll be at the heart of our client's success story, leading the full spectrum of People & Culture across a dynamic, multi site organisation. From designing future ready workforce strategies to embedding safety, wellbeing, and inclusion into everything they do - this is your chance to lead with impact.

Reporting to the COO and working closely with the CEO, you’ll combine strategic vision with hands on leadership. You’ll lead an enthusiastic P&C team, drive business aligned initiatives, and ensure people, systems and policies are ready for the next stage of growth.

What You’ll Do

Shape and deliver a bold, scalable people strategy aligned with growth plans

Ensure compliance with workplace laws and lead WHS initiatives across all sites

Lead high performing recruitment and talent pipelines

Champion a culture of inclusivity, engagement and wellbeing

Design compensation, benefits and performance frameworks that attract and retain top talent

Drive strategic workforce planning and organisational development

Lead key projects and bring big picture thinking to life

Be a trusted advisor to the executive team and a visible leader across the business

What You Bring

7+ years in broad, senior HR roles - ideally in retail, FMCG, or other fast paced, consumer facing environments

Proven experience in high growth businesses

Deep knowledge of Australian employment law, WHS and industrial relations

A future focused mindset and the drive to build agile, scalable people systems

Empathy, resilience, and a hands on, energetic leadership style

Bonus points for experience in geographically dispersed teams
